South Eastern Trains ... WebGoudhurst is a closed railway station on the closed Hawkhurst Branch in Kent, England. [1] History [ edit] The station originally opened on 1 October 1892 as Hope Mill, for Goudhurst & Lamberhurst, [2] when the line was opened from Paddock Wood. [3]
